About the role
Mozn is seeking for a skilled and motivated Mid-Level Full Stack Developer with experience in Java(17)/Kotlin, React, and TypeScript.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in both front-end and back-end development, with at least 4 years of professional experience coding in these technologies. You will be working on a variety of projects, contributing to the development and maintenance of high-quality, scalable web applications, and collaborating closely with our cross-functional teams.
What you'll do
- Develop and maintain web applications using Java(17)/Kotlin, React, and TypeScript.
- Design and implement RESTful APIs , microservices and various independent components with a focus on scalability and performance.
- Collaborate with UX/UI designers to translate design concepts into functional, responsive web interfaces.
- Write clean, efficient, and maintainable code, adhering to best practices and coding standards.
- Participate in code reviews, providing constructive feedback to peers and ensuring the delivery of high-quality code.
- Troubleshoot, debug, and optimize existing applications to improve performance and user experience.
- Participate in Deployment and On-call rotas to maintain smooth production operations.
- Work closely with product managers and stakeholders to understand requirements and deliver solutions that meet business objectives.
- Continuously learn and stay updated on industry trends and technologies to ensure the use of modern, relevant tools in development.
Qualifications
- Experience: Minimum of 4 years of professional experience coding in Java/Kotlin, React, and TypeScript.
- Education: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related field, or equivalent work experience.
- Technical Skills:
- Strong proficiency in either Java or Kotlin and experience with web frameworks such as FastAPI.
- Solid experience with front-end development using React and TypeScript.
- Familiarity with modern front-end build pipelines and tools (Webpack, Babel, etc.).
- Experience with version control systems, particularly Git.
- Understanding of RESTful API design and implementation.
- Experience with relational databases (e.g., PostgreSQL, MySQL) and ORMs.
- Knowledge of containerization technologies (e.g., Docker)
- Familiarity with cloud platforms (any AWS, Azure, GCP, OCI).
